Output 40a91624022c2945937852734b8581bd051714e179e8e91a752ff7d98eeec738:3

value
986388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5829aa1d36246903ceb7fc5f3f13ac32d1524146 OP_EQUAL
address
39jBJKqcoRX8pw5ZMLF6N391JRuwJhrnNy
transaction
40a91624022c2945937852734b8581bd051714e179e8e91a752ff7d98eeec738
spent
true